The Role of Data Science in Strengthening Cybersecurity

With the advent of technology, cybersecurity has become one of the most crucial areas of focus across different industries. As businesses continue to rely on digital mediums to support their operations, the threat of cyber-attacks has risen to alarming levels. However, thanks to the advancements in data science, there is a new hope for enhancing cybersecurity across different organizations.

What is Data Science?

Data science is an interdisciplinary field that combines different techniques, algorithms, and tools to find meaningful insights from structured and unstructured data. Data science has become increasingly popular in recent years, with organizations leveraging their data to make better decisions and drive growth. Data science uses different techniques such as machine learning, data mining, statistical analysis, and natural language processing to extract insights from data.

The Role of Data Science in Cybersecurity

Cybersecurity has become a significant concern for nearly every industry in the world today. Organizations are continuously looking for ways to boost cybersecurity to prevent cyber-attacks. The use of data science offers significant advantages in the fight against cybercrime. Data science can help organizations protect their networks and systems by detecting and preventing cyber-attacks in real-time.

Data science models can be trained on historical data to identify patterns and anomalies that occur during cyber-attacks. These models can then be used to monitor systems continuously to detect any suspicious behavior. In addition, data science models can be used to predict potential cyber-attacks based on existing threats in the cybersecurity landscape.

Data Science Techniques for Cybersecurity

Data science techniques can be used to protect the networks, systems, and applications from cyber-attacks. Below are a few data science techniques that are used in cybersecurity.

Machine Learning

Machine learning is one of the most significant data science techniques used in cybersecurity. It is used to identify patterns in data that may indicate malicious behavior. Machine learning algorithms can learn from historical data and detect anomalies in real-time.

Natural Language Processing

Natural language processing is another data science technique used in cybersecurity. It helps analyze data in natural language to detect abnormalities. This technique is useful in identifying phishing scams.

Data Visualization

Data visualization helps analysts understand the data better by creating visual representations of information. Interactive data visualizations help analysts explore data, identify patterns, and detect anomalies.

Big Data Analytics

Big data analytics involves using advanced mathematical and statistical techniques to analyze large data sets. Big data analytics can help detect cyber-attacks in real-time by analyzing large amounts of data from different sources.
